alternator brackets....... on the setup we bought it seems the bottom bracket is lowered, as the new one i have points down and the bolts are on top, as aposed to standard and there underneath.

the top mount, is longer and i think it has a bigger bend in it as the alternator sits slightly further away from the inlet manfold as if it were the old manifold.

The alternator bracket does need to be extended. You can use one from a cavi SRI 8v as these are longer. Or use two Nova ones connected together. The length doesn't have to be exact I don't think as you will need some room for adjustment for your alternator belt tension. The lower bracket will need to be lowered. I made mine up with a thick metal plate with four holes in, two for the mounting of the plate to the engine, then two lower down to move the alternator down to avoid the inlet manifold. You may have to try several alternator belts until you find the correct one to fit your set up. As for the trumpets, the 10mm size you are quoting is I guess length from the carb up the outside of the trumpet to the end. I have seen several lengths and to be honest it doesn't matter as long as you can get your air filters to fit over the ends of them. I have used shorter trumpets so they don't knock the soundproofing on the bulkhead on engine movement. These work fine with Pipercross sock airfilters as they just slip over the trumpets. I don't know the exact measurment off the top of my head though of what I have.
